Though a quaint and modest station, Gypsy Lane is equipped with essential facilities that ensure an easy travel experience. Ticket machines are available where you can collect tickets purchased online or in advance. These machines are designed to be accessible to everyone, including those requiring mobility support. Although there's no ticket office or staff assistance directly at the station, help is available via the helpline.
For your security, CCTV operates throughout the station, offering peace of mind as you await your train. However, facilities such as toilets, waiting rooms, refreshment centers, and car parking are not available. So, it's a good idea to come prepared! Bicycle enthusiasts will find limited storage with two cycling spaces available.
Pondering on how to get to or from Gypsy Lane? Although the station itself does not have direct bus services or taxi ranks, alternative travel options are easily accessed. Rail replacement services pick up and drop off at Cypress Road Bus Stops, conveniently located adjacent to the Brunton Arms pub. If you're thinking of getting a taxi, you can explore options online via services like Cab4You. Unfortunately, bus services are not available in close proximity to the station.

Situated in the heart of the charming town of Linlithgow, just 20 miles west of Edinburgh, Linlithgow train station serves as a key gateway to a wealth of Scottish locales. Whether you're a local heading into the city for work, a student, or a traveler exploring Scotland, the station offers a blend of essential amenities and convenient transport links to make your journey smooth and enjoyable.
The station is equipped with a ticket office that operates from early morning until late at night, ensuring that you can always secure a ticket for your travels. For those who prefer online booking, ticket collection is facilitated by accessible ticket machines located at the station. Moreover, for passengers with hearing impairments, an induction loop is available, enhancing accessibility.
Independently navigating the station is straightforward due to the comprehensive step-free access provided throughout. Despite having no accessible toilets, the station offers waiting rooms on both platforms where travelers can also access public Wi-Fi. If you're looking to grab a quick refreshment, a coffee vending machine is on hand to cater to your caffeine needs before you embark on your journey.
Linlithgow station boasts substantial connectivity with various modes of transport ensuring seamless travel. Should railway services be disrupted, a rail replacement service operates with buses picking up passengers from High Street. For detailed information about bus services, visit Traveline Scotland or call their 24-hour hotline. Taxi services are equally accessible, with details available at TrainTaxi.
Parking is hassle-free with a no-charge policy, as there are 96 parking spaces available, inclusive of two blue badge spaces. Cyclists are also catered to with a covered bicycle storage area accommodating up to 38 bikes, protected by CCTV for enhanced security.
